UK regulator Ofcom has launched a consultation on extending access to spectrum in the Ku-band (14.35-14.5 GHz) for satellite operators. Ofcom says additional spectrum is needed to increase broadband services in rural and remote locations, including offshore energy facilities. Ireland’s Comreg is inviting comments on the proposed lease of spectrum rights in the 3.3-3.8 GHz band. Imagine Ireland Communications Limited is seeking to continue its lease of the 3.6 GHz band from Vodafone and Meteor. Kosovo's regulator ARKEP is consulting on its draft frequency distribution plan for the 3.4 - 3.8 GHz band. ARKEP wants to use the band for fixed and mobile communication networks (MFCN).
